Did you know
- TriviaThe bar where the film was shot was still in business, so daily shooting had to finish by 4:00 p.m. when it opened for the evening to the public.
- GoofsIn the opening shot of Ichabod and Mary in the pickup truck, a crew person can be seen standing in the back of the truck in a reflection of several passing storefront windows.

Featured review
A very hard to find movie but still a great movie.
The Last Night At the Alamo is a GREAT movie. It took me forever to find it but when I did I was not disappointed. I have heard and read about it and many people have said that its a Texas classic. I had to buy it off EBAY and I had tried 3 times before only to outbid by 100$. That shows you how bad some people wanted this rare treasure. This movie had a very simple plot that anyone who has ever stepped foot in a bar can relate to. Its in black and white to give you that old western kind of a feel. Overall a great movie I just wish there was a way the video could be more distributed. If I am correct this movie is out of print and can only be bought or located by people who are willing to sell the video. If you stumble upon it buy it.
